Output 152a1fe3bb64426cc17a314df2137506c0932472387893194f3e537077f7c44b:16

value
574620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c1fe5278a80d00c6841ef57f54109cab63888ea OP_EQUALVERIFY OP_CHECKSIG
address
1FEWd3E1EftyamZCgm8kbiimEkagZvMPzb
transaction
152a1fe3bb64426cc17a314df2137506c0932472387893194f3e537077f7c44b
confirmations
390526
spent
true